Default
By default, footer-info is hidden for all users, and footer-custom (with a login link as standard content) will only be shown to anonymous users.
This is how the footer looks for anonymous users:
| CONFIG | Messages | Configuration Options |
|---|---|---|
|
$wgTweekiSkinHideAll['footer-info'] = true;
$wgTweekiSkinHideLoggedin['footer-custom'] = true; | |

footer-info contains information about the time of the last edit and about the copyright.
You can additionally set $wgMaxCredits to a non-zero value to show one, some or all of the contributors to a page.
| CONFIG | Messages | Configuration Options |
|---|---|---|
| $wgTweekiSkinHideAll['footer-info'] = false; | ||
